Tournament Overview
The CONCACAF Champions League is an annual continental club football competition organized by CONCACAF. It determines the champion of the region and earns them a spot in the FIFA Club World Cup. The 2022 edition featured some significant changes and exciting developments. The tournament format included a knockout stage, starting with the Round of 16, followed by Quarter-finals, Semi-finals, and the Final. Teams from various leagues, including Liga MX (Mexico), Major League Soccer (MLS) in the United States and Canada, and other Central American and Caribbean leagues, participated, making it a diverse and competitive field. The Final Showdown: Seattle Sounders vs. Pumas UNAM
The final of the CONCACAF Champions League 2022 was a captivating clash between Seattle Sounders and Pumas UNAM, a series that ultimately saw Seattle make history. The first leg, played at the Estadio OlĂmpico Universitario in Mexico City, ended in a 2-2 draw, setting the stage for an electrifying second leg in Seattle. Pumas UNAM initially showed resilience, battling to secure the draw at home, with Juan Dinenno scoring twice to keep his team in contention. However, the return leg at Lumen Field was a different story. Seattle Sounders came out strong, buoyed by their home crowd, and delivered a dominant performance. RaĂșl RuidĂaz scored twice, and NicolĂĄs Lodeiro added another goal from the penalty spot, sealing a 3-0 victory for the Sounders and a 5-2 aggregate win. This triumph marked a significant milestone as Seattle Sounders became the first MLS team to win the CONCACAF Champions League since its rebranding in 2008.
